Develop a waste audit worksheet that suits your type of business. The worksheet should list all products used in your operations by category such as office paper, newspaper, cardboard, glass, metal, plastic, food waste and yard waste. Special Wastes and Drop-Off SitesOct 13, 2021 · Effective July 1, 2018, Ordinance 17-37 amended the plastic bag ban. Businesses are required to charge customers a minimum of 15 cents per reusable, compostable plastic or recyclable paper bag they provide to customers at the point of sale for the purpose of transporting groceries or other merchandise.
